Participants
of the November 2005 Live-in McDougall Program in Santa
Rosa, CA had the special opportunity to meet T. Colin
Campbell, PhD, author of the national best-selling book, the
China Study, and his wife, Karen Campbell.
Raised on a
dairy farm, Dr. Campbell eventually became the world’s most
recognized nutritionist—and an opponent of the big food
industries.
Over many
years Dr. Campbell’s research has focused on how eating
protein, and especially dairy protein, encourages cancer
growth. He has spent decades working on national and
international food and health policies, and publishing
hundreds of scientific papers. Many years ago Dr. Campbell
became aware of the deplorable state of nutrition research
and policy making, and the resulting public information in
the U.S. Information produced by the food industry, and
their allies in the government, confuses and cheats members
of the public out of their health by selling them on the
importance and safety of meat and dairy products.

Dr. Campbell
is best known for his research in rural China and Taiwan --
research that surveyed a total of 170 villages to determine
the relationships of diet and lifestyle to common diseases.
This work became known as the China Study (published
in 1990), and is regarded as the most comprehensive
study of diet, lifestyle and disease ever completed. The
New York Times called the China Study “the Grand
Prix of Human Epidemiology.” This landmark research shows
that even small increases in the consumption of animal-based
foods are associated with an important increased risk of
disease.

The recently published book (2004),
The China Study, by Dr. Campbell and his son
Thomas M. Campbell II, has become an instant national
best-seller, and is one of the few books on Dr. McDougall’s
highly recommended list. (Dr. McDougall and Dr. Campbell
have been friends and have worked together to change the way
people think about food for more than 15 years.)
